[技术问题解答] imx6q emmc 命令使用

[复制链接]
3937|8
 楼主| ach_dmatek 发表于 2015-8-18 16:59 | 显示全部楼层 |阅读模式
我要把emmc中的内容完全擦除掉,在uboot下有什么命令可以操作吗?
643757107 发表于 2015-8-18 18:36 | 显示全部楼层
进入uboot终端:
运行
1、选择emmc
U-Boot# mmc dev 1
mmc1(part 0) is current device
2、擦除emmc。
U-Boot# mmc erase 0 20000
MMC erase: dev # 1, block # 0, count 2097152
IversonCar 发表于 2015-8-18 20:33 | 显示全部楼层
楼上正解,擦除也有命令吧
 楼主| ach_dmatek 发表于 2015-8-19 08:56 | 显示全部楼层
按照643757107给出的方法测试,结果如下:
TIM08 U-Boot $ mmc dev 3
mmc3(part 0) is current device
TIM08 U-Boot $ mmc erase 0 20000

MMC erase: dev # 3, block # 0, count 131072 ... 131072 blocks erase: OK
我的emmc设备使用了3口。貌似擦除成功。
从新启动之后,uboot任然可以启动,但是无法引导核心启动了,貌似进入到fastboot烧写模式。启动信息如下:
Hit any key to stop autoboot:  0
booti: device don't have such partition:boot
fastboot is in init......flash target is MMC:3
Bad partition index:1 for partition:boot
Bad partition index:2 for partition:recovery
Bad partition index:5 for partition:system
USB Mini b cable Connected!
fastboot initialized
USB_SUSPEND
USB_RESET
USB_RESET
afei8856 发表于 2015-11-20 16:43 | 显示全部楼层
fasboot模式不能用吧
Micachl 发表于 2015-11-21 18:08 | 显示全部楼层
643757107 发表于 2015-8-18 18:36
进入uboot终端:
运行
1、选择emmc

这个是问题的答案,相应的擦除也有命令
小猫爱吃鱼 发表于 2015-11-22 17:57 | 显示全部楼层
643757107 发表于 2015-8-18 18:36
进入uboot终端:
运行
1、选择emmc

按照层主的说法,成功了,谢谢你了
Luis德华 发表于 2015-11-22 19:52 | 显示全部楼层
这个命令是可以的,根据二楼的提示就可以了
cortex-yuan 发表于 2016-8-9 10:28 | 显示全部楼层
ach_dmatek 发表于 2015-8-19 08:56
按照643757107给出的方法测试,结果如下:
TIM08 U-Boot $ mmc dev 3
mmc3(part 0) is current device


##### EmbedSky BIOS for E9 #####
Hit any key to stop autoboot:  0
booti: device don't have such partition:boot
fastboot is in init......flash target is MMC:3
Bad partition index:1 for partition:boot
Bad partition index:2 for partition:recovery
Bad partition index:5 for partition:system
USB Mini b cable Connected!
fastboot initialized
USB_SUSPEND
您需要登录后才可以回帖 登录 | 注册

本版积分规则

13

主题

178

帖子

3

粉丝
快速回复 在线客服 返回列表 返回顶部